filters:122 size:12 KB
Clear All Filters
AllSaints Brown Madea Leopard Print Cross-Body Bag
£199
Oliver Bonas Green Isla Cross-Body Bag
£52
Lauren Ralph Lauren Brown Reese Leather Logo Bucket Bag
£229
Lauren Ralph Lauren Black Reese Leather Logo Bucket Bag
Neutral Straw Effect Cross-Body Bag
£28
River Island Green Ruched Cross-Body Bag
£36
River Island Black Mini Metal Handle Quilted Tote Bag
River Island Red Cherry Camera Cross-Body Bag
£32
Osprey London The Electra Italian Leather Phone Bag
£149
Osprey London Blue The Lyra Leather Crossbody Bag
£135